Geffner Atemoya

Geffner Atemoya (Annona squamosa × Annona cherimola)

Source tree from Shamus O'Learys Tropical Fruit Trees, Apr 2016

Atemoyas do really well here. It is not planted in full sun, but most-day sun (gets a little overhead protection from 12-1 from a Brazilian Pepper tree, which somewhat filtered light in the afternoon). But in summer the leaves never looked scorched like they do on my cherimoyas. They stay nice and green. And it tolerates the winter (not happily like the cherimoyas, but certainly better than sugar apples). My Geffner has flowered every spring I have had it. No fruit yet. The tree is getting to the size where it could hold fruit, so I might try hand pollinating this year.
